titleOfInvention |
Method for enhancing or inhibiting insulin-like growth factor-I |
abstract |
The present invention provides αVβ3 integrin cysteine loop domain agonists and antagonists (including peptide agonists and antagonists and analogs thereof), along with methods of using the same. |
